The Pearls of Pearl Street 30

Extinction Rebellion Cardiff Arts came and stencilled these figures on the wall in protest at the new incinerator planned locally in CF3. Splott already has one incinerator !

There are very high poor quality air levels in and around Splott, Adamsdown and Tremorfa. These areas of Cardiff are more typically working class and culturally diverse.

With Cardiff ranked 4th worst in the UK for air pollution and the poorer parts of town effected to a greater extent. The residents of CF3 are campaigning against a 2nd incinerator within their postcode. There is already one within the residential district that looms over the landscape and blots the skyline.

With evidence clearly showing the reduction in years of average life expectancy due to poor air quality XR Cardiff Arts have been busy cutting stencils to raise awareness and engage the local community as there are 10 days left to get objections in.

The Pearls of Pearl Street 28

Two themes close to my heart. Having been unable to participate in the demonstrations and actions that have been happening across the UK during September, I thought to contribute and support the cause by using my wall as a platform for the images.

Not surprisingly the subject matter has generated a lot of positive responses and discussions but also some angry abuse by passers by who seem to want to vent from across the road and not engage in any back and forth of ideas or conversation.

Climate Change and Racism are inextricably linked and I hope that this wall will keep them at the forefront of our awareness as we negotiate this world as it goes through various states of lock down
